Qarah Tappeh (Persian: قره تپه, also Romanized as Qareh Tappeh)[1] is a village in Jafarbay-ye Jonubi Rural District, in the Central District of Torkaman County, Golestan Province, Iran. At the 2006 census, its population was 829, in 174 families.[2]
